I have a 1991 90hp Johnson. I bent to my output shaft and sheared off most of the skeg this last summer (hit a BIG rock in Canada). Seems easier to replace the whole lower unit than fix the old one. Will a lower unit from a 1995 115hp fit on my 90hp. Looks like it would, but wanted to check with the experts.

Thanks for the help.

Re: 90hp lower unit swap

Yes, it will work. If the 95 unit is from a 60* 115 you'll have to use your shift shaft. If it's from a 1995 crossflow 115, the shift shaft is the same.

The biggest difference will be the driveshaft O ring is in the crank on a 1995. On you'rs the driveshaft O ring is on the driveshaft. Basically you'll end up with no d/s O ring. Just use a good water-proof grease on the splines and you'll be fine. It won't hurt to drop the lower each year and re-grease.
